How We Work
1
Emergency Call & Dispatch
Your urgent call to Rochester Restoration Pros immediately dispatches our certified technicians. We gather initial details about the water intrusion to prepare our rapid response team. Expect us quickly.
2
On-Site Assessment & Scope
Upon arrival, we use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ely identify all affected areas, even hidden moisture. This detailed assessment allows us to create a comprehensive drying plan, preventing secondary damage.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ered extractors remove standing water efficiently. We then strategically place industrial air movers and dehumidifiers to thoroughly dry the structure. This critical step sets the stage for restoration.
4
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Once dry, our team repairs any damaged materials, from drywall to flooring, restoring your property to its pre-loss condition. A final inspection ensures complete satisfaction and quality. Your property is ready.

Clogged Drain Water Removal Cost In Pittsford, NY

Prices for Clogged Drain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pittsford, NY. These estimates are a general guideline and may not reflect the actual cost of the service.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Clogged Drain Repair and Maintenance $200 - $1,500 Location and accessibility of the clog, complexity of the repair.
Standing Water Extraction $1,000 - $5,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Disinfection and Sanitizing $100 - $500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Complete Water Damage Restoration $2,000 - $10,000 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
